Import SEG-Y Synthetics

The Import SEG-Y Synthetics dialog allows you to import SEG-Y synthetic files from other software packages.

General Information


SEG-Y Files

Files:Open a file browser to select the SEG-Y files.

Remove All:Remove all the files from the list of files.

Remove:Remove the selected files from the list of files.

Wells

A list of all the wells in the project. The SEG-Y files must be associated with specific wells. You can set the UWI to associate a file with by selecting the file and then clicking on one of the wells and clicking .  You also select the file and then double click on the well in the list.  A final method is to select the file and then select the well from the map.

To help you make your well selection, left click on the column headers to sort the column, apply a filter (), or type a search string into the search bar to limit the list using UWI, Name, or Owner information.

For additional selection and navigation options right click on the Wells list to access the shortcut menu.

Output Options

Synthetic Name: This item allows you to set the name of the synthetic for the selected file.  Select a file from the list, type in a name, and hit the Setbutton. You can also set the name of the file by hitting the Enter key after typing in the name. 

Set: Button used to associate a synthetic in the SEG-Y Files list with a well in the Wells list.

Data Options

Assume IBM floating point: Some software packages output IBM floating point data, but do not set the flag in the SEG-Y file that indicates it is IBM data.  Check this off  if you know the data is IBM floating point data rather than IEEE floating point data.
